back to top

Lโ€™oggetto screen di Javascript

Lโ€™oggetto screen contiene una serie di informazioni relative allo schermo del device utilizzato dallโ€™utente.

Questo oggetto ha la particolaritร  di disporre solo di proprietร  e di nessun metodo.

Pubblicitร 

Proprietร  dellโ€™oggetto screen

  • availWidth e availHeight โ€“ (GET) restituisce le dimensioni dello schermo esclusa la taskbar;
  • colorDepth โ€“ (GET) restituisce la profonditร  del colore (bits x pixel);
  • pixelDepth โ€“ (GET) restituisce la risoluzione colore dello schermo (bits x pixel);
  • width e height โ€“ (GET) restituisce le dimensioni dello schermo;

Vediamo un esempio di utilizzo delle proprietร  width e height per stampare a video la risoluzione dello schermo delโ€™utente:

var w = screen.width;
var h = screen.height;
document.write(w + 'x' + h);

NOTA: La proprietร  colorDepth e pixelDepth sono, nella pratica, equivalenti. La prima รจ supportata quasi universlamente mentre la seconda lo รจ solo dai browser piรน recenti.

Pubblicitร 
Massimiliano Bossi
Massimiliano Bossi
Stregato dalla rete sin dai tempi delle BBS e dei modem a 2.400 baud, ho avuto la fortuna di poter trasformare la mia passione in un lavoro (nonostante una Laurea in Giurisprudenza). Adoro scrivere codice e mi occupo quotidianamente di comunicazione, design e nuovi media digitali. Orgogliosamente "nerd" sono il fondatore di MRW.it (per il quale ho scritto centinaia di articoli) e di una nota Web-Agency (dove seguo in prima persona progetti digitali per numerosi clienti sia in Italia che all'estero).